The 'Anatomy of an Agency' Infographic is an Office Dissection Diagram

If you work for an agency of some kind, you may find yourself falling into one of the illustrated categories of the 'Anatomy of an Agency' infographic, which takes hilariously spot-on stereotypes and makes them seem statistical.

The chart is broken down into columns, one of which includes examples of recent Google searches made by the likes of copywriter, developer, finance or accounts positions. It examines common drawer contents of the crew, their spirit animals and even their favorite pickup lines such as the art director Casanova who may throw out the statement, "I can fill your white space."

The Anatomy of an Agency infographic is a super funny formulation of categorized quirks that would make for some seriously good material to bring to the next water cooler conversation.
